What is Bipolar Disorder?
What is Bipolar Disorder: Bipolar Disorder affects many people in the world. It can look like typical depression but it lasts longer and can have some very different side effects. Bipolar Disorder has two different stages. The first stage is manic. The manic stage deals in the hyperness of a person; this can pose itself just as a “sugar high” of sorts and can make a person feel as though they are high as a kite.
Here are some of the side effects that spawn from the manic stage:
- Racing thoughts
- Euphoria
- High esteem
- Risky behavior
- Delusions
- Poor judgment
- Increased sex drive
- Shopping sprees
- Use of drugs or alcohol
The second stage of bipolar disorder is the depression side. Here are some of the side effects which come from depression:
- Guilt
- Sleep problems
- Anxiety
- Less or more eating
- Suicidal thoughts
- Sadness
- Fatigue
- Hopelessness
- Irritability
Bipolar disorder can present itself as simple mood swings or even as what some would call “alter egos” because it shows a complete swing of a person from manic to depression. There are very many reasons as to why a person would find themselves bipolar but the main one is due to genetics. However, there could be an imbalance in hormones or too much stress on a person that they become mentally exhausted leaving them vulnerable for chemical imbalances in the brain. If you find yourself overworked, mentally exhausted, have gone through a traumatic experience or know for a fact that bipolar disorder runs in your family and have been feeling the symptoms listed above, it would be a good idea to talk with your doctor. People who suffer from bipolar disorder tend to have more risk for heart disease, obesity or even thyroid problems. So it is best to have yourself checked out.
